Abstract

Background: Definite diagnosis and treatment of Cushing's syndrome is still a dilemma. The aim of this study was to evaluate the accuracy of diagnostic tests and follow-up of patients with Cushing's syndrome.
Methods: Two hundred and fifty three consecutive cases with Cushing's syndrome during 1370-78 were studied. The screening tests were performed in all patients. High dose dexamethasone suppression test (HDDST) and ACTH measurement were carried out. MRI/CT Scan were performed and compared with laboratory data and pathologic specimens as a gold standard test.
Results: The age range was 32±11 yrs. The most frequent symptoms were weakness hypertension, typical striae, and depression .The frequency of hypertension in ACTH-dependent case were 77% vs. 36% in adrenal tumors (P< 0.001). HDDST was positive in 99% of micro and 71% of macroadenomas. Adrenal tumors showed 3.6% suppression but none in ectopic cases. HDDST had a sensitivity of 98%, specificity of 97% and accuracy equals to 98%. The frequency of different etiologies was as following: Cushing's disease in 64.8%, adrenal tumors in 32.8% and ectopic ACTH in 2.4% of patients. Trans-sphenoidal surgery (TSS) was performed in 120 patients .The patients were followed for 53±25 months whose remission periods were 46.7±23.8 months (range 4-114 months). Survival analysis showed 93% remission rate in 12mo, 82% in 2yr and only 33% after 5yr.This recurrence didn't have any platue level.
Conclusion: In our study, hypertension was more prevalent in ACTH-dependent Cushing's syndrome. HDDST had acceptable sensitivity, specificity and accuracy. Lifelong follow up of pituitary adenomas is inevitable in the case of progressive and gradual nature of recurrence in these tumors.

Abstract

Background: Staphylococcal superantigens (SAg&aposs) may have some role in otitis media with effusion (OME). The aim of this study was the search of staphylococcal SAg&aposs in middle ear effusion of children with OME. 
Methods: This cross sectional-analytic study was done in ENT & pediatric wards upon 64 children with otitis media with effusion (OME) between 1-15 years, (mean age=7.42+4 years) of Rasoul Akram University Hospital, Tehran, Iran in 2009-2011. Fifty six percent (36) of cases were male, 43.8% (28) were female. Staphylococcal SAg&aposs Toxic Shock Syndrome Toxin-1 (TSST-1), Staphylococcal enterotoxin A, B, C, D (Enzyme immune assay, AB Cam, USA) were detected in middle ear effusion samples after conventional culture.
Results: None type of SAg&aposs found in 39% of OME cases, enterotoxin B found in: 22% enterotoxin A: 17%, enterotoxin C: 15.6%, enterotoxin D: 12.5%, Toxic Shock Syndrome Toxin-1 (TSST-1): 7.8% Mean age of cases with positive TSST-1, enterotoxin A, B, C, and D was: 1, 5, 8.6, 9.6 and 9.6 years respectively. Positive TSST had no agreement with positive enterotoxin A and C but had weak agreement with type B and D. Mean age of cases with positive TSST was one years which had significant difference with (7.9 years) in cases with negative TSST test (P<0.0001).
Conclusion: At least one or more type of staphylococcal toxins had found in middle ear effusion of 70% of OME cases with negative culture for Staphylococcus aureus. Even in culture negative cases, staphylococcal toxins might have some immunologic role in middle ear effusion forming. Finding the SAg&aposs (at least one type) are important for treatment of immunosuppressive or corticosteroid in cases with resistant OME.

Abstract

Background: Toxic shock syndrome (TSS), a dangerous consequence of Toxic shock syndrome toxin-1 (TSST-1) caused by Staphylococcus aureus. The early detection for infections of Staphylococcus aureus in burned children is very important, also the pre-vention for consequences of TSST-1. Fever is one of the most noticeable sign in burned children. On the other hand, fever is one of the important consequences of TSST-1 pro-duction. Methods: This study aimed to assess the toxic shock syndrome toxin-1 level in the wound’s specimens of two groups febrile and afebrile in the hospitalized burned chil-dren in Motahari hospital Tehran, Iran in the year 2013. In this case-control study, 90 children who admitted to the burn unit, divided in two groups of 45 patients: febrile (cases group) and afebrile (control group). All of burned children under went wound biopsy, and then all of wound’s specimens were tested by PCR for specific primer of toxin producing genome. Finally all of data collected and statistically analyzed. This data include group febrile and afebrile, demographic characteristics, percentage of burned surface severity and result of PCR. Results: The positive result for PCR test, production of TSST-1 in febrile burned chil-dren (cases group) was 37.7% and in afebrile burned children (control group) was 11.1% that this different was statistically significant (P=0.003). The mean and stan-dard deviation for percentage of burned surface (severity) in samples with positive re-sult for PCR test was 30.9±16.93 and in samples with negative result for PCR test was 20.09±11.02 that this different was statistically significant (P=0.01). There was no dif-ference between positive PCR result and negative PCR result of age and sex. Conclusion: Direct association was approved between the production of TSST-1 and the occurrence of fever in burned children. Increased surface severity of burns also re-lated to the production of TSST-1. Further research is recommended.

Abstract

Background: Staphylococcus aureus is one the most common pathogens causing community-acquired infections and a major concern for public health, and the other hands antibiotic resistance is also of great concern for public health authorities also Staphylococcus aureus produce a lot of virulence factors such as variety of exoproteins included toxic shock syndrome and exfoliative toxin which causes colonization and different infections in their host. The aims of current study were to evaluate the prevalence of Toxic shock syndrome toxin 1 (TSST-1) and ETs genes in isolated S. aureus strains using polymerase chain reaction (PCR) assay. Methods: This cross-sectional study was performed on 100 methicillin-resistant staphylococcal aureus (MRSA) and 100 methicillin-sensitive staphylococcal aureus (MSSA) isolated from clinical specimens of inpatients, outpatients hospitals and nasal carriers in Hamadan University from October 2013 to August 2014. Identified species by biochemical methods were confirmed by the PCR method. Antibiotic resistance was performance by disk diffusion and the presence of TSST-1 and ETs genes was investigated using PCR. Results: Of the 100 isolates MRSA examined, the most frequent resistance was observed to ciprofloxacin (95%), followed by tetracycline (91%), erythromycin (92%), Gentamicin (90%), Rifampin (85%), trimethoprim-sulfamethoxazole (85%), clindamycin (80%) and cefoxitin (100%). Of the 100 isolates MSSA examined, the most frequent resistance was observed to erythromycin (68%), ciprofloxacin (66%), followed by tetracycline (52%), gentamicin (25%), clindamycin (46%), rifampin (45%), trimethoprim-sulfamethoxazole (66%) and cefoxitin (0%). Prevalence of TSST-1 and ETs genes were determined 13% (n=26) isolates, totally. Also the prevalence of TSST-1 was 11% (n=22) and ETs genes was 2% (n=4) isolates and none of the investigated isolates carried eta gene. Conclusion: The increasingly prevalence of MRSA and emerging its antibiotic resistance in clinical isolates can be considered a serious problem for public health. Detection of the high rate prevalence of TSST genes in current study is considered as a serious problem and existing and circle of these strains in according to colonization in community especially old people and immunocompromised patients is very serious.
